Abstract:

The author of this essay was raised on a largely rational and scientific diet of educational, religious, and personal formation; it hence took some time for him to recognize that most of the important realities of life required a different attitude and deportment. These he learned from providential introductions to psychotherapy, poetry, and alternative philosophies. A recent visit to India confirmed this adjustment and direction.
